    • President and CEO
      • Jul 1993 - Dec 2017

      Atlanta, GA The Georgia Public Policy Foundation is a nonprofit, nonpartisan research institute focused on state public policy. Research Director (1993); Executive Director (1994 to 2008); President and Chief Executive Officer (2009 to 2017) Responsibilities include managing a professional staff of 3-5 full-time employees and 8-14 part-time contract employees; writing and editing research studies; speeches to civic, business and policy groups; media interviews in print and electronic media; expert testimony before state and federal legislative committees; fundraising including membership development, grant writing, donor database management and major donor solicitation; event planning; project management; marketing; negotiating leases and contracts; human resources; budgeting and accounting; coalition building; recruiting and developing boards, and strategic planning.
